Transaction ec3e03bf00297ea53c69b2409be538985f71d953d69c51e5f8d75de5c84726e0
1 Input
2 Outputs
- ec3e03bf00297ea53c69b2409be538985f71d953d69c51e5f8d75de5c84726e0:0
- ec3e03bf00297ea53c69b2409be538985f71d953d69c51e5f8d75de5c84726e0:1
value 1276317
address 3CuFtKFtrcoRvsPxbUN8xKDBFnoaSxWw72
value 2799087
address 1PFcatJLGChyqCZqxxGmQYB956cAXnoCzJ